Transaction 232567664d3cb22dcf37768f0d399580b66cc19bbcef2a343cd85bf5f124d9e9

1 Input
2 Outputs
  • 232567664d3cb22dcf37768f0d399580b66cc19bbcef2a343cd85bf5f124d9e9:0
  • value  1621062
    address  3CmNR3krGBCYNPXvDEtkQdAKhuYfT5aYfG
  • 232567664d3cb22dcf37768f0d399580b66cc19bbcef2a343cd85bf5f124d9e9:1
  • value  35770921
    address  bc1qazf9wttx8ygugw23phxa2nmv96j8hkhhdasj3k